My guess is that the people porting from QNX were just confused
and their use of D-Bus was in error.  Maybe they should've used
plain sockets, capnproto, ZeroMQ or whatever.
I tend to trust that they knew what they were doing, they wouldn't have
picked D-Bus for no good reason.
The automotive developers I had the pleasure to work with would
use anything which is available via a mouse click in the
commercial Embedded Linux SDK IDE of their choice :)
Let's face it: QNX has a single IPC solution while Linux has
a confusing multitude of possibilities.
Greg, from my spell in IVI, I too have to say your faith in the
wisdom of IVI developers' choices is touching. I think D-Bus was 
in the main picked because it had some nice features, but then 
people realized it had no bandwidth, and the solution has been 
"make D-Bus faster", rather than "maybe we should explore 
other (mixed model) solutions". This isn't to say that I'm
against adding kdbus, but I don't think there's much strength to
the argument you make above.
